From bba736e5036f3983ca22f08dec277fdf37926115 Mon Sep 17 00:00:00 2001 From: Kamil Rytarowski Date: Thu, 10 Sep 2020 20:09:53 +0200 Subject: [PATCH] [compiler-rt] [netbsd] Update generate_netbsd_syscalls.awk Sync with NetBSD 9.99.72. --- compiler-rt/utils/generate_netbsd_syscalls.awk | 34 ++++++++++++++++++++++++++ 1 file changed, 34 insertions(+) diff --git a/compiler-rt/utils/generate_netbsd_syscalls.awk b/compiler-rt/utils/generate_netbsd_syscalls.awk index cc7ba31..1bddc0f 100755 --- a/compiler-rt/utils/generate_netbsd_syscalls.awk +++ b/compiler-rt/utils/generate_netbsd_syscalls.awk @@ -1167,6 +1167,8 @@ function syscall_body(syscall, mode) pcmd("/* TODO */") } else if (syscall == "dup2") { pcmd("/* Nothing to do */") + } else if (syscall == "getrandom") { + pcmd("/* TODO */") } else if (syscall == "fcntl") { pcmd("/* Nothing to do */") } else if (syscall == "compat_50_select") { @@ -1431,6 +1433,12 @@ function syscall_body(syscall, mode) pcmd("/* TODO */") } else if (syscall == "sysarch") { pcmd("/* TODO */") + } else if (syscall == "__futex") { + pcmd("/* TODO */") + } else if (syscall == "__futex_set_robust_list") { + pcmd("/* TODO */") + } else if (syscall == "__futex_get_robust_list") { + pcmd("/* TODO */") } else if (syscall == "compat_10_osemsys") { pcmd("/* TODO */") } else if (syscall == "compat_10_omsgsys") { @@ -3027,6 +3035,32 @@ function syscall_body(syscall, mode) pcmd(" PRE_READ(fhp_, fh_size_);") pcmd("}") } + } else if (syscall == "__acl_get_link") { + pcmd("/* TODO */") + } else if (syscall == "__acl_set_link") { + pcmd("/* TODO */") + } else if (syscall == "__acl_delete_link") { + pcmd("/* TODO */") + } else if (syscall == "__acl_aclcheck_link") { + pcmd("/* TODO */") + } else if (syscall == "__acl_get_file") { + pcmd("/* TODO */") + } else if (syscall == "__acl_set_file") { + pcmd("/* TODO */") + } else if (syscall == "__acl_get_fd") { + pcmd("/* TODO */") + } else if (syscall == "__acl_set_fd") { + pcmd("/* TODO */") + } else if (syscall == "__acl_delete_file") { + pcmd("/* TODO */") + } else if (syscall == "__acl_delete_fd") { + pcmd("/* TODO */") + } else if (syscall == "__acl_aclcheck_file") { + pcmd("/* TODO */") + } else if (syscall == "__acl_aclcheck_fd") { + pcmd("/* TODO */") + } else if (syscall == "lpathconf") { + pcmd("/* TODO */") } else { print "Unrecognized syscall: " syscall abnormal_exit = 1 -- 2.7.4